WebSwollen or red eye (or eyelids) Watery or thick (sometimes smelly) dog eye discharge Squinting Tearing Blinking excessively Sensitivity to light Pawing or rubbing at the eye, or keeping the eye closed If your pooch is suffering from a viral eye infection, they may also act lethargic or have a fever. WebMar 29, 2024 · Eye infections often feel hot and itchy so the dog may paw at the affected eye or rub it along the ground. In addition, the dog may squint or keep the eye partially closed. A secondary staph infection can occur when inflammation from allergies goes unchecked for several days. You may notice the fur falling out around the eye.
